Output 852cd3c62db88029166b694ba39f9726e51ee903a4d5367138943891df815df1:6

value
22347354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870c82f98e147d706a9c98c65315180804d41554 OP_EQUAL
address
3E168mEd46Yw6nSwdWimtFVuEYrz5qAotG
transaction
852cd3c62db88029166b694ba39f9726e51ee903a4d5367138943891df815df1
spent
true